Avoid Forex Fraud: Red Flags of Dishonest Brokers

Diving into the world of forex trading can be exciting, but it's crucial to stay vigilant. Unfortunately, fraudulent brokers lurk in the shadows, eager to cheat unsuspecting traders. To safeguard yourself from falling victim to a scam, be on the lookout for these warning signs.

  • Guarantees of unrealistically high returns are a major warning sign. Legitimate brokers understand that forex trading carries inherent risks and won't guarantee you riches.
  • Urgency to deposit funds quickly is another indication of a scam. Reputable brokers will give you time to evaluate their offerings and never demand immediate payment.
  • Unregulated brokers often operate outside legal frameworks, making it difficult to recover your funds if something goes wrong. Always choose a broker that is authorized by a reputable financial authority.

Be aware that due diligence is essential when choosing a forex broker. Thoroughly investigate their credentials, read reviews from other traders, and don't hesitate to ask questions about anything that seems unclear.

Avoid the Trap: Unmasking Forex Trading Scams

The forex market can be alluring, promising quick riches and effortless success. Unfortunately, this very popularity attracts scammers who prey on naive traders. It's crucial to beware of common red flags that signal a potential scam. One major clue is promises of unrealistic returns with little to no risk. Legitimate forex trading always involves some level of risk. Be wary of anyone guaranteeing consistent profits or claiming to have a magic system.

Another warning sign is pressure tactics, such as urging you to make quick decisions or invest large sums without proper research. Scammers often use manipulation to cloud your judgment and pressure you into acting impulsively. Remember, legitimate forex brokers operate transparently and never force you to invest.

Before parting with any money, always carefully investigate the broker or trading platform you're considering. Check for licensing from reputable authorities, read independent reviews from other traders, and understand their fees and conditions. Never feel pressured to act without taking your time to make an informed decision.
